Output f23d2017c2a32bfdf05f978488cc86ae3f1b6900603ab8117892f8ea6c4d0c6a:0

value
40000000
script pubkey
OP_0 OP_PUSHBYTES_20 8709a81ac56da8a120a828e118d0dfd819139965
address
bc1qsuy6sxk9dk52zg9g9rs335xlmqv38xt9azn87h
transaction
f23d2017c2a32bfdf05f978488cc86ae3f1b6900603ab8117892f8ea6c4d0c6a
spent
true